Football having tail fins
Abstract
A football having tail fins includes a football body and at least two rear tail fins which extend outward from a rear of the football body. Each of the tail fins are not parallel relative to the longitudinal axis of the football body. The tail fins may have a straight or curved length. In a second embodiment, a longitudinal pole member extends from a rear of the football body. At least two rear fins extend outward from the longitudinal pole member. Each of the rear fins are not parallel relative to the longitudinal axis of the football body. The rear fins preferably spiral around the perimeter of the pole. A hole may be formed in a rear of the football body which is sized to receive a weighted device or a light emitting device.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1 . A football having tail fins comprising:
a football body having a longitudinal axis; and at least two fins extending outward from a rear of said football body, a length of each said fin not being parallel with said longitudinal axis.
2 . The football having tail fins of claim 1 wherein:
a front of each said fin being disposed before said longitudinal axis.
3 . The football having tail fins of claim 1 wherein:
a bevel being formed on a back edge of each said fin.
4 . The football having tail fins of claim 1 wherein:
said at least two fins being spaced equidistance from each other.
5 . The football having tail fins of claim 1 wherein:
each said fin having a length which is straight.
6 . The football having tail fins of claim 5 wherein:
a front perimeter of each of said fins having a a convex curvature and a rear perimeter thereof having a concave curvature to facilitate better air flow and less drag.
7 . The football having tail fins of claim 1 wherein:
each said fin having a length which is curved.
8 . The football having tail fins of claim 7 wherein:
a front perimeter of each of said fins having a a convex curvature and a rear perimeter thereof having a concave curvature to facilitate better air flow and less drag.
9 . The football having tail fins of claim 1 wherein:
said football body and said at least two fins being fabricated from a single piece of material.
10 . The football having tail fins of claim 1 wherein:
at least two slots being formed in a rear of said football body, said slots being sized to receive said at least two fins.
11 . The football having tail fins of claim 1 , further comprising:
a weighted device; and said football having an opening formed in a rear thereof, said opening being sized to receive said weighted device.
12 . The football having tail fins of claim 11 , further comprising:
said weighted device including a rod body having a plurality of cavities formed along a length thereof and a plurality of weights being sized to be firmly received by said plurality of cavities.
13 . The football having tail fins of claim 11 , further comprising:
said weighted device including a hollow body filled with a dense material.
14 . The football having tail fins of claim 1 , further comprising:
a light emitting device; and said football having an opening formed in a rear thereof, said opening being sized to receive said light emitting device.
15 . The football having tail fins of claim 14 , further comprising:
said light emitting device including a body, a plurality of lamps, and at least one battery, said at least one battery providing power to said plurality of lamps.
16 . A football having rear fins comprising:
a football body having a longitudinal axis; a pole extending from a rear of said football body; and at least two fins extending outward from said pole, a length of each said fin not being parallel with said longitudinal axis.
17 . The football having tail fins of claim 16 wherein:
each said fin having a height which gradually increases from said football body to an end of said pole.
18 . The football having tail fins of claim 16 wherein:
each said fin being disposed in a spiral around said pole.
19 . The football having tail fins of claim 16 wherein:
said football body, said pole, and said at least two fins being fabricated from a single piece of material.
20 . The football having tail fins of claim 16 wherein:
